using System;
using System.Collections.Generic;
using System.ComponentModel;
using System.Data;
using System.Drawing;
using System.Linq;
using System.Text;
using System.Threading.Tasks;
using System.Windows.Forms;
namespace App
{
public partial class Alert : Form
{
public bool ButtonClicked { get; set; }
public Alert(string title, string label, string buttonText = "Ok")
{
InitializeComponent();
Text = title;
label1.Text = label;
button1.Text = buttonText;
}
private void button1_Click(object sender, EventArgs e)
{
ButtonClicked = true;
DialogResult = DialogResult.OK;
Close();
}
}
}

using System;
using System.Collections.Generic;
using System.ComponentModel;
using System.Data;
using System.Drawing;
using System.Linq;
using System.Text;
using System.Threading.Tasks;
using System.Windows.Forms;
namespace App
{
public partial class Prompt : Form
{
public string ReturnValue { get; set; }
public Prompt(string title, string label, string buttonText)
{
InitializeComponent();
Text = title;
label1.Text = label;
button1.Text = buttonText;
}
private void button1_Click(object sender, EventArgs e)
{
ReturnValue = textBox1.Text;
DialogResult = DialogResult.OK;
Close();
}
}
}
